NCDOT approved to move forward with newest plans for I-26 connector despite concerns

ASHEVILLE, N.C. (WLOS) — The North Carolina Department of Transportation (NCDOT) has received approval to move forward with the newest plans for the Interstate 26 Connector project, according to an NCDOT release.

The Federal Highway Administration has reevaluated the plans for the northern section of the project, which spans from the Haywood Road/Interstate 240 Interchange to the north end, due to revisions that have occurred since the Record of Decision was issued in 2023.

As previously reported, in June 2025, Asheville Mayor Esther Manheimer and Buncombe County Commission Chair Amanda Edwards called on NCDOT to reconsider the plans for the eight-lane flyover, saying the community still opposes it and wants the plans to be revised…
